Pinnacle Industrial Group is evaluating a sale-leaseback arrangement with Industrial Capital Partners. The lease requires Pinnacle to make semi-annual payments of $187,500 at the beginning of each period for 8 years (16 payments total). Using a semi-annual discount rate of 4.125% (reflecting Pinnacle's weighted average cost of capital adjusted for lease risk), calculate the present value of Pinnacle's lease obligation as it would appear on the balance sheet under current accounting standards.
Correct Answers
present_value
$2,254,093.96
Step-by-Step Solution
Present Value of Annuity (annuity due): Payment (PMT): $187,500.00 Rate per period (r): 4.1250% Periods (n): 16 PVA (ordinary) = PMT × [1 − (1+r)^−n] ÷ r PVA = $187,500.00 × [1 − (1+4.1250%)^−16] ÷ 4.1250% PV Factor = 11.545579 PVA (ordinary) = $2,164,796.12 Annuity due: PVA × (1+r) = $2,164,796.12 × 1.041250 = $2,254,093.96
